Are the physio balls a part of S.M.A.R.T.?

0

No, the physio balls are not a part of S.M.A.R.T. but they can be used as a S.M.A.R.T. strategy. Asking kids to balance and giving them the sensory information is an important aspect of the S.M.A.R.T. program. Physio balls can provide an opportunity to positively impact important readiness skills, however, their use could be equated to our need for the sun. Some is needed and beneficial to our wellbeing but more is not better for you. Using a ball in place of a classroom chair works great in limited situations to focus attention, provide an outlet for the wiggles, to provide sensory feedback, and develop posture or core strength. Elementary and particularly early elementary or primary age children are intermittent exercisers. Physiologically they are set up to exercise intensely in short bursts.
